U.S. Supply Chain Management Market - Report Scope:
Supply chain management (SCM) solutions are essential for optimizing logistics, inventory control, procurement, and distribution networks across various industries. These solutions leverage art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), cloud computing, and blockchain to enhance operational efficiency, reduce costs, and improve decision-making processes. The U.S. supply chain management market caters to industries such as retail, manufacturing, healthcare, automotive, and food & beverages. Market growth is driven by increasing adoption of digital transformation initiatives, advancements in real-time tracking technologies, and the growing demand for efficient logistics management solutions.
Market Growth Drivers:
The U.S. supply chain management market is propelled by several key factors, including the increasing complexity of global supply chains and the need for real-time visibility and predictive analytics. The rise of e-commerce and omnichannel retailing has intensified the demand for SCM solutions to streamline inventory management and last-mile delivery operations. Additionally, the adoption of AI-driven demand forecasting and automation technologies is enhancing supply chain agility and resilience. Furthermore, the integration of blockchain technology for secure and transparent transactions is gaining traction, ensuring better risk management and regulatory compliance across the supply chain.
Market Restraints:
Despite promising growth prospects, the U.S. supply chain management market faces challenges such as high implementation costs, data security concerns, and integration complexities with legacy systems. Many enterprises struggle with transitioning from traditional supply chain models to digital SCM platforms due to resistance to change and the need for extensive workforce training. Additionally, cybersecurity threats, including data breaches and ransomware attacks, pose risks to cloud-based SCM platforms, necessitating robust security measures. Moreover, supply chain disruptions caused by geopolitical uncertainties, trade restrictions, and natural disasters continue to impact market stability.
Market Opportunities:
The U.S. supply chain management market presents significant growth opportunities driven by advancements in IoT-enabled logistics, robotic process automation (RPA), and the increasing adoption of software-as-a-service (SaaS)-based SCM platforms. The rise of sustainable supply chain practices, including green logistics and carbon footprint reduction initiatives, is also creating new avenues for market players. Additionally, the expansion of 5G networks and edge computing is expected to revolutionize supply chain connectivity, improving data processing speeds and operational efficiencies. Strategic collaborations, mergers, and acquisitions will further drive market expansion, enabling businesses to enhance their supply chain capabilities and competitiveness.

Competitive Intelligence and Business Strategy:
Leading players in the U.S. supply chain management market, including SAP SE, Oracle Corporation, IBM Corporation, and Manhattan Associates, focus on technological advancements, cloud-based solutions, and strategic partnerships to gain a competitive edge. These companies invest in R&D to develop AI-powered predictive analytics, IoT-integrated tracking systems, and blockchain-enabled secure supply chain solutions. Collaborations with logistics providers, retailers, and manufacturers facilitate seamless supply chain operations and improve service delivery. Moreover, emphasis on automation, digital twin technology, and sustainability initiatives fosters market growth and enhances supply chain resilience.
